Output 3dbf39060333ef5fe60672e2f9df75fb1fe5d46ea39d8dc73e2d31c82963c605:0

value
8145016345
script pubkey
OP_0 OP_PUSHBYTES_20 aed3e41176929046febb0939e094a8c21c2091cc
address
tb1q4mf7gytkj2gydl4mpyu7p99gcgwzpywvtdu649
transaction
3dbf39060333ef5fe60672e2f9df75fb1fe5d46ea39d8dc73e2d31c82963c605
confirmations
74326
spent
true